The first problem with a nitro crawler is that nitros don't crawl, they run over things. The Revo in the traxxas vid did a nice job of running over the rocks but it didn't actually crawl over them. A good crawler (like the ones we watch with wide eyes in the vids) has a top speed of around 3-5 mph. Have you ever seen a nitro put out real torque at that speed? Even if you could get it going that slow and have the torque you need, the engine and clutch would have trouble with over heating. Electric is cheaper and easier plus it has a butt load of torque at very slow speeds.
